There are allegations against all those who’re excluded from election

    Lt. Gen. (Retd.) Mahbubur Rahman speaks to DOT : 
    I vehemently condemn the harassment and false allegations made against BNP leaders. Many BNP leaders got themselves rejected from the election due to their own shortcomings. Some of them have bank loans while some have not yet repaid theirs. There are allegations against all those exlcuded from the election. I don’t believe the government has any hand in this. I criticize leaders from all spheres. They should’ve prepared their nomination papers properly.

    They formed the election board from the party, and thus they were excluded. This shows their irresponsibility, since they’re all big leaders – some of them organizational secretaries, while others district or central leaders. No, this cannot be accepted. They were excluded because of their own political short-sightedness, indifference and negligence.
